OLIVER WILSON TITLE
Mylar commission 1
Mylar commission 1
BACK
Oil on canvas  92cms x 126cms

PAINTINGS 

PHOTOGRAPHY 

BIOGRAPHY 

EXHIBITIONS 

PRESS 

CONTACT